hp_glplotf、hp_gl2plotf

用途

hp_glplotf 将 Alias plot 文件转换为 HP-GL (IBM GL) 格式的文件,适合在任何支持的绘图仪上打印。

hp_gl2plotf 会创建类似的输出,但是会包含 HP-GL2 绘图仪所需的初始化命令。

概述

hp_glplotf 和 hp_gl2plotf 是从标准输入或 <in_file> 接受输入并将输出发送到标准输出或 <out_file>(通常发送到 lp)的过滤器。

说明

hp_glplotf [-a] [-c<x>[<y>]] [-h] [-i] [-m<model>] [-n] [-p<paper>] [-r<angle>] [-s] [t # #] [<in_file> [<out_file>]]  
-a 指定使用自动进纸。
-c<x>[<y>] 指定比例校正系数。
-h 显示联机帮助。
-i 显示版本信息。
-m<model> 指定绘图仪型号。
-n 对 HPGL plot 命令换行。
-p<paper> 指定纸张类型。
-r<angle> 指定强制绘图的旋转角度。
-s 自动调整生成的绘图的大小。使用绘图仪的默认大小。
-t # # 指定文本比例,其中 # 和 # 是宽度和高度。
<in_file> 从 <in_file> 文件读取输入。默认设置是从标准输入读取。
<out_file> 将输出写入到 <out_file> 文件。默认设置是写入到标准输出。
注:

HP-GL 和 IBM-GL 设备驱动程序遇到的所有错误都将写入“/tmp/plot_err<number>”和“/usr/adm/syslog”文件 在这些文件中寻找绘图仪无法使用的原因。<number> 由操作系统确定。

自动进纸

某些绘图仪可以配备假脱机进纸,或包含自动进纸选项。这也适用于 IBM-4019 和 IBM-4029 等可以自动进纸的打印机。若要让绘图仪驱动程序知道您正在使用假脱机进纸选项,应指定以下选项:

-fa

校正系数

在绘制较大的图时,某些不精确的因素可能会导致逐渐产生过大的距离。作为临时修复方法,可以通过指定 x 和 y 校正系数来补偿此误差。默认的 x 和 y 校正系数是 1.0,即根本不进行任何校正。校正系数在内部作为乘数使用。

示例

如果绘制的对象本应凸出 30",而实际上却凸出到 30.125",则说明该图偏大 0.125"。假定在 x 和 y 方向上出现相同的误差,将需要校正系数 30/30.125 = 0.9959。以下命令应可以补偿该误差:

-fc0.9959
注:

如果在“Plotting Interface”窗口(通过“File”>“Plot”打开)中设置校正值,将覆盖“Alias Preferences”窗口的图输出部分“LP queue options”中的校正值。